Biography
Assistant Professor of Environmental Soil Microbiology Plant & Environmental Sciences Department, N328 Skeen Hall, New Mexico State University PO Box 30003, MSC 3Q, Las Cruces, NM 88003, USA Tel: 575-646-1910; npietras@nmsu.edu PROFESSIONAL APPOINTMENTS/EMPLOYMENT 2015-present Assistant Professor, Plant & Environmental Sciences Department, New Mexico State University. 2015-2015 Research Associate and Lab Manager, The Holden Arboretum, Kirkland, Ohio. 2014-2015: Collection Curator and Research Associate, John Carroll University. 2012-2013: Post-Doctoral Researcher, John Carroll University. EDUCATION 2008 – 2012: Ph.D., Soil and Water Sciences, University of California – Riverside. 2005 – 2007: M.S., Biology, John Carroll University. 2002 – 2003: Study abroad, Geography and Environmental Biology, St. Andrews University, Scotland UK. 1998 – 2005: Diploma of Geography, Major: Geography, 1st Minor: Biology 2nd, Minor Geology, University of Leipzig, Germany.
Research Interest
Soil Microbiology, Phycology, Desert Soil Ecology, Biocrusts
